I just bought a Sennheiser hd598se and it sounds really well plug it in to my iPhone 8 Plus.
But I want to try if there’s a difference with an amp so I plugged the headphone to an Sony AV receiver in my living room and the sound improves a lot. The separation is a lot better and it improves the soundstage as well. Bass was a lot puchy too.
I want to have the same experience in my room so I don’t have to go out to my living room every time I want to enjoy music. So I bought a Fiio E10K and Fiio q1 Mark II to plug in to my computer to try and see which one I like better. But no matter how I tweak the device and eq I can’t have the same sound quality as when I plug in to the receiver.
And the thing is I think the Fiio sounded the same as when I just plug the headphone in to my iPhone.

Is there an amp dac combo that’s reasonably priced I can purchase to have the sound quality as my receiver.

For the receiver I used an Apple TV to my tv via hdmi and tv to my receiver via digital audio.

The bass response could be due to high output impedance on the receiver. As much as you can probably find a headphoone amp with high output impedance, the problem there is that even if they're roughly the same the effects can vary across amp and headphone combinations, so you're basically going to gamble on whether the old Rega Ear or a Musical Fidelity V90-HPA will have the same kind of EQ effect as the Sony receiver.
